Section 21B — Human Rights Act 1993: Relationship between this Part and other law

Text of the provision Official document

21B Relationship between this Part and other law (1) To avoid doubt, an act or omission of any person or body is not unlawful under this Part if that act or omission is authorised or required by an enactment or otherwise by law. (2) Nothing in this Part affects the New Zealand Bill of Rights Act 1990 . Sections 21A and 21B were inserted, as from 1 January 2002, by section 7 Human Rights Amendment Act 2001 (2001 No 96).
